A fabricated concrete frame type steel bracket vibration and earthquake double-control beam column joint belongs to the technical field of recoverable functional structures and comprises a prefabricated column, a prefabricated beam, a high-strength type steel bracket, a friction pendulum, a thick-layer rubber support and a U-shaped energy dissipation steel plate assembly, the prefabricated column is provided with the high-strength type steel bracket, the thick-layer rubber support is arranged in the high-strength type steel bracket, the friction pendulum is arranged in the thick-layer rubber support, and the U-shaped energy dissipation steel plate assembly is arranged in the thick-layer rubber support. A friction pendulum is arranged at the top of the high-strength steel bracket, the bottom of the friction pendulum is connected with the top of the thick-layer rubber support through a connecting piece penetrating through the top of the high-strength steel bracket, the top of the friction pendulum is connected with the top face of a tongue-and-groove of the prefabricated beam, and the high-strength steel bracket and the lower end and the side face of the prefabricated beam are wrapped with the U-shaped energy dissipation steel plate assembly. The high-strength steel corbel and the lower end and the side face of the precast beam are connected through a U-shaped energy dissipation steel plate assembly. The fabricated concrete frame type steel bracket vibration double-control beam column joint has good effects in the aspects of safety, comfort and economy in environmental vibration control.
